What is the tool for, its device and types of tool

Clamp refers to additional carpentry and metalwork tools. The main purpose of the clamps is to fix the workpiece on the support surface or several workpieces for gluing them together, therefore, the design of the tool must include at least two elements: the support surface and a movable jaw equipped with a locking mechanism. The movement of the movable jaw is carried out, as a rule, with the help of a screw or a lever, which makes it possible to increase compression and prevent reverse movement during operation. Depending on the specialization and design features, the following types of clamps are distinguished:

  1. Screw G-shaped - the most common, they are distinguished by their simplicity of design and relatively low cost. Represented by a metal bracket, on one side of which there is a supporting surface, and on the other, a threaded eye with an adjusting screw screwed into it. The inner part of the screw is equipped with a working sponge, the outer part is equipped with a handle. The tool is effective when working with heavy, large workpieces of a simple shape.

  2. F-shaped - more versatile, their supporting surface is fixedly fixed on a long rod, along which the working block with a sponge slides. Movement and fixation of the block is provided by an auxiliary screw or a step-by-step pressing mechanism.

  3. Pipe - allow you to fix large-sized workpieces by varying the length of the pipe. They consist of two separate elements - a base plate with a screw clamp and a sponge sliding along the pipe.

  4. Corner - designed to simplify the joining of workpieces at a right angle, for which they have two supporting and working surfaces. They are divided into two subspecies. The first involves the presence of two clamping screws located perpendicular to each other; the second is equipped with one screw with a double-sided angle block at the end. Very rarely there are specialized clamps that allow you to place workpieces at an acute or obtuse angle.

  5. Tape - equipped with a flexible element and several sponges floating on it. By fixing the jaws in certain places of the tape and adjusting its tension, it is possible to process workpieces of complex shape.

  6. Pincer - consist of two hinged parts and a spacer spring. In practice, they are rarely used due to the relatively low reliability of the joint, however, they provide the maximum speed of installation and removal of the workpiece.

At home, clamps of the first three types are most often made, since they are not too demanding on materials and production technologies, and also allow you to solve most household tasks that require the use of auxiliary tools.

Making a screw type tool

This type of clamp will help to fix wood workpieces well.

A clamp made according to this technique is perfect for fixing small wooden blanks - plywood, fiberboard, OSB and chipboard sheets, as well as boards and thin timber. We suggest that you choose the scale yourself, but otherwise it is better not to deviate from the following sequence of actions:

  1. Transfer the templates of all wooden parts to thick paper or cardboard in accordance with the selected scale.
  2. Using the template, transfer the image to a suitable board width. It is better to use not pine boards, but harder wood.
  3. Using a jigsaw, cut out all the details. Correct the shape with a file, and sand the surface with sandpaper.
  4. In the "jaws" mark and drill holes for the axle bolt. Lengthen the hole of the upper “jaw” with a round file so that its length is 1.5–2.5 of the bolt diameter.
  5. In the handle, drill a hole for the nut, with a diameter corresponding to the number of the wrench. With a needle file, give it a hexagonal shape. Install the nut inward with epoxy or cyanoacrylate.
  6. Assemble the clamp - fix the axial bolt in the lower “jaw” with glue, install the rear loop on the screws, put on the upper jaw and, placing the washer, install the handle. Stick soft pads on work surfaces.

Metal pipe

For the manufacture of such a clamp, a metal pipe is required.

For such a tool, you will need three metal rings, the inner diameter of which corresponds to the outer diameter of the pipe you have, instead of which, by the way, you can use a metal rod. In the presence of a welding machine, the process of manufacturing a clamp is reduced to the following algorithm:

  1. Weld support pads to two rings, which can be made from a steel corner; install a nut on the third ring, and weld the ring itself to the end of the pipe.
  2. Weld an impromptu handle made of a metal rod to the head of a long bolt, screw the bolt into a ring with a nut.
  3. From the free end of the pipe, put the ring of the upper movable sponge on it. In the ring of the lower jaw, make holes for the fixing pins.
  4. Install the lower ring on the pipe.

The pipe clamp is optimally suited for holding furniture elements during its assembly, it will be convenient in construction and installation work and other similar operations.

With this device, you can glue boards made of wood of different sizes. The clamp itself is easy to use and has a fairly simple design. With the right materials, making such a clamp for a home workshop will not be difficult.

For the manufacture of home-made clamps (they are also called clamps), you will need a stud with M10 nuts, a 20 mm steel strip and two rectangular shaped pipes with sides of 40x20 mm, 80 cm long. These materials can be bought inexpensively at a hardware store.

Clamps for gluing shields: stages of work

On profile pipes we make markings and drill through holes every 15 cm, using a conventional or stepped drill for this. We cut the steel strip with a grinder into segments 150 mm long. In these plates, we drill two holes of the desired diameter.

Profile pipes are connected to each other using plates. You will also need stops - movable square and fixed T-shaped, welded from a profile with side dimensions of 20x20 mm. We screw a hairpin of a suitable length into the movable clamp.


Features of using a clamp

It is good because, when gluing wooden shields, it clamps the workpiece on four sides in two planes. Thus, the gluing is of very high quality. By rearranging the T-shaped fixed stop, you can adjust the length. See the video on our website for the assembly process of the clamp for gluing wooden shields.

corner option

Regardless of the type of clamp, it must firmly clamp the parts for their connection or processing. Corner joinery helps to fasten wood blanks at a certain angle (most often 90 °, but there are others). This is indispensable when assembling furniture and frames.

In order to make such a wooden clamp with your own hands, you will need the following materials:

  • two wooden bars 25 mm thick hardwood;
  • plywood 12 mm thick or more;
  • self-tapping screws, studs;
  • jigsaw or hacksaw;
  • drill.

A square board with a side of 25 or 30 cm is cut out of plywood. Two bars are fixed on it at an angle of 90 °.

Important! The angle must be measured with high accuracy, since the correct fixation of the parts depends on it.

First, the bars are glued, then they are countersinked, holes are drilled with a drill and self-tapping screws or other fasteners are screwed in. Perpendiculars are drawn from the center of the bars - screw studs will pass here.

At a distance of 20 mm from the corner bars, persistent bars are fixed, maintaining a gap between them. It should be slightly larger than the width of the parts to be clamped with a homemade clamp. It is better to screw in the studs immediately, before fixing the stops. You will also need to cut out the movable pads that will be connected to the pin (when it is unscrewed, the workpiece will be pressed against the corner bar).

As a screw, it is best to take studs with a rectangular or trapezoidal thread. The thread pitch is 2 turns per cm. It is very good if on the stud on one side there is a pillar of a slightly smaller diameter than the thread. It can be used to fit the handle. On the other hand, a slightly larger diameter rear sight is desirable to fit the bearing.

So, in the simplest clamp, one end will be fixed, and the other will advance through a worm gear.

To release the workpiece, you need to move the bracket to the required distance and turn the knob a few turns. Thus, the element is fixed. After that, you can release the mechanism and the workpiece will be released.

For gluing boards (shield)

Clamping clamps are needed to fix the plots, which, after the glue has dried, are used for furniture panels. Such products differ from simple ones in their length. In other words, they have a large jaw span. If you buy such material in a store, you will have to pay a decent amount. Therefore, craftsmen prefer to make clamping mechanisms on their own.

Materials and assembly steps

In order to make wood clips, you will need the following items:

  • beech or birch bar;
  • drill bit;
  • pipe 2.5 cm;
  • mortise nuts of suitable diameter;
  • a nut that has a rounded knob (used for decoration);
  • cutter with a diameter of 2.5 cm and a long hairpin.

The basis of the material is a pipe, from which a piece of the required length is cut. Depending on the size of the sponges, it is necessary to saw the bar. The pieces should be from 15 to 20 cm. For the free movement of the timber through the pipe, make a hole with a diameter of 2.5 cm at a distance of 2.5 cm from the edge. Parallel to the hole, cut from the same end. To fix the sponge on the pipe, connect the hole to the end.

For the drive nut, an additional hole must be drilled to the side of the cut. It is necessary to hammer a nut into it and tighten it from the back with a bolt. To fix the sponge, clamp the pipe in the hole. To move the pipe, unscrew the bolt, then move the element and repeat all the steps again.

There are 2 jaws in the lower clamping part, it is slightly larger than the upper one and has an additional nut. In terms of structure, both parts are the same. An additional driving nut is located at the opposite end of the pipe, into which a stud with a wing nut is inserted.

In the second collapsible movable part, there are no clamping parts such as cuts and nuts. The size of such an element is also rather big. In this part, it is necessary to make a recess for the stud device.

Operating principle

The principle of operation of the clamp is very simple. It is necessary to dilute the extremely sponges so that they are at a distance of 3 cm more from each other than the width of the shield to be installed. Next, you need to fix them on the pipe. To do this, clamp the nuts that are located along the edges. The blanks must be put on the tubes and sealed with glue. Then they need to be pulled together with the help of the “lamb” rotation.

With the ability to use a grinder and a welding machine, you can make the same clamp for gluing wood from metal.

To maintain the plane of the plot with tubes, it is recommended to arrange the clamps in a checkerboard pattern. The main advantage of such a tool is the ease of manufacture and operation.
